Tested By the Devil

In the wild for forty days was a test. As he hungered the devil did suggest turning stones into bread so that he could be fed. “There's more to life than bread.” Jesus did stress. Up at the top all the world could be seen. “Its kingdoms could be yours and all between, if me you would worship you'd have a power trip.” “Worship is for God, all else is obscene.” From high on the temple, right at the lip, “Throw yourself down for there's a scripture tip that in angels' arms you'll come to no harm.” “Test not your God.” He gave Satan the slip. Luke 4.1-13
